• When Monitored: • Set Condition: Possible Causes VEHICLE DAMAGE STEERING COLUMN / INTERMEDIATE SHAFT DAMAGE STEERING WHEEL ALIGNMENT STEERING ANGLE SENSOR LOOSE STEERING ANGLE SENSOR IMPROPERLY INSTALLED (WRONG MOUNTING POSITION) WIRING HARNESS, TERMINAL, CONNECTOR DAMAGE (A913) FUSED IGNITION SWITCH OUTPUT (RUN-ACC) CIRCUIT HIGH RESISTANCE (Z910) GROUND CIRCUIT HIGH RESISTANCE STEERING ANGLE SENSOR ANTI-LOCK BRAKES MODULE Diagnostic Test 1. PERFORM TEST DRIVE & VERIFY DTC IS STILL ACTIVE Turn the ignition on. With the scan tool, erase ABS DTCs. Cycle the ignition switch. WARNING: Ensure brake capability is available before road testing. Park the vehicle. With the scan tool, read ABS DTCs. Does this DTC reset? Yes >> Go To 2 No >> Refer to the INTERMITTENT CONDITION diagnostic procedure. Perform ABS VERIFICATION TEST - VER 1. (Refer to 5 - BRAKES - STANDARD PROCEDURE). 2. INSPECT VEHICLE, STEERING COLUMN, & INTERMEDIATE SHAFT FOR DAMAGE NOTE: If possible, check vehicle repair history for collision damage. Inspect the vehicle for damage causing tracking problems or steering wheel misalignment. Inspect the steering column and intermediate shaft for damage. Were any problems found? Yes >> Repair as necessary. Perform ABS VERIFICATION TEST - VER 1. (Refer to 5 - BRAKES - STANDARD PROCEDURE). No >> Go To 3 5 - 294 BRAKES - ABS ELECTRICAL DIAGNOSTICS LX |
